Before purchasing a treadmill, it's necessary to understand the different types readily available on the market:

  1. Manual Treadmills

    • Operated without electrical energy-- users offer the power.
    • Easier style without intricate electronics.
    • Suitable for those looking for a standard walking or jogging experience.
  2. Motorized Treadmills

    • Function electric motors that drive the belt.
    • Offer numerous speed settings and often come with additional features (e.g., slope changes).
    • Best fit for more major runners and those trying to find a series of workout alternatives.
  3. Folding Treadmills

    • Can be folded when not in use, taking full advantage of space in smaller homes.
    • Frequently motorized and equipped with contemporary functions.
    • Perfect for individuals with limited exercise area.
  4. Commercial Treadmills

    • High-quality building and robust functions developed for heavy day-to-day use.
    • Normally discovered in gyms, however some home physical fitness lovers buy them for a premium experience.
    • More pricey but include innovative features like larger screens and more workout programs.
  5. Smart Treadmills

    • Geared up with innovative technology, such as interactive screens and connection to fitness apps.
    • Often integrate with virtual training programs for enhanced user experiences.
    • Suitable for tech-savvy people who enjoy gamified workouts.
Elements to Consider When Choosing a Treadmill

When picking an at-home treadmill, it's essential to examine numerous elements to guarantee it satisfies your requirements:

  • Space: Evaluate the available area in your house for a treadmill, considering both the footprint and the folding capability.
  • Budget plan: Determine how much you are ready to invest; treadmills can range from a few hundred to a number of thousand dollars.
  • Features: Consider functions that enhance your experience, such as adjustable incline, speed settings, and incorporated fitness tracking.
  • Weight Capacity: Ensure the treadmill can support your weight and accommodate any extra users.
  • Warranty: Check the service warranty offered by the producer-- this can supply peace of mind about the durability of the treadmill.

Often Asked Questions (FAQs)

1. How much area do I need for a treadmill?

  • Ideally, allocate an area of at least 6-7 feet in length and 3-4 feet in width to supply adequate room for safety and movement.

2. Are manual treadmills efficient for weight-loss?

  • Yes, manual treadmills can be reliable for weight reduction as they need more effort to use. Nevertheless, they might not use the same speed and incline options as motorized models.

3. How frequently should I utilize my treadmill?

  • For ideal benefits, go for a minimum of 150 minutes of moderate aerobic activity or 75 minutes of vigorous activity each week, spread throughout the week.

4. Is a clever treadmill worth the financial investment?

  • For tech lovers or those who grow on inspiration from interactive exercises, smart treadmills can improve the at-home exercise experience considerably.

5. What maintenance is needed for a treadmill?

  • Regularly inspect the belt positioning, tidy the surface area, lubricate the belt as needed, and guarantee all electronic elements are functioning properly.
